@charset "utf-8";

* { padding: 0; margin: 0;}
body {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 62.5%;
	color: #FFFFFF;
}

.clearer { clear:both }
.staff { float:left; }


#wrapper > h1 {
	background-image: url(../images/h1.gif);
	height: 80px;
	width: 420px;
	text-indent: -9999px;
	float: left;
}
#content h1 {
color:#9DC3E0;
font-size:2.4em;
margin-bottom:30px;
}
h2 {
	color: #9DC3E0;
	font-size: 2em;
	font-weight: normal;
	letter-spacing: -0.05em;
	margin-bottom: 15px;
}
h3 {
	font-size: 1.4em;
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#9DC3E0;
	margin-bottom: 6px;
}
h4 {
	font-size: 1.4em;
	margin-bottom: 4px;
	color: #9DC3E0;
}



p {
	font-size: 1.2em;
	margin-bottom: 12px;
}
a {
	color: #FFFFFF;
	text-decoration: none;
	border-bottom-width: 1px;
	border-bottom-style: dotted;
	border-bottom-color: #FFFFFF;
}

a:hover {
	text-decoration: none;
	border-bottom-color: #006633;
}
ul {
	font-size: 1.2em;
	padding-left: 25px;
	padding-bottom: 12px;
}
li {
	margin-bottom: 4px;
}









#wrapper {
	width: 880px;
	margin: 0 auto;
	position: relative;
}
#homeContent {
	background-image: url(../images/home_main_bg.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	height: 500px;
	width: 880px;
}
#content {
	width: 880px;
	background-repeat: no-repeat;
	background-position: left bottom;
}
#content.content1 {background-image: url(../images/content_bg_dog.jpg);}
#content.content2 {background-image: url(../images/content_bg_cat.jpg);}
#content.content3 {background-image: url(../images/content_bg_gpig.jpg);}
#content.content4 {background-image: url(../images/content_bg_rabbit.jpg);}


#innerContent {
	color: #658426;
	margin-left: 300px;
	padding-top: 38px;
	min-height:470px;
	height:auto !important;
	height:470px;

}

#footer {
	background-image: url(../images/footer_bg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	padding-top: 10px;
	font-size: 0.8em;

}
#tel {
	float: right;
	margin-top: 47px;
	font-size: 2em;
	color: #89B134;
}
#homeDiv1 {
	height: 95px;
	width: 310px;
	position: absolute;
	left: 33px;
	top: 364px;
}
#homeDiv2 {
	height: 80px;
	width: 157px;
	position: absolute;
	left: 552px;
	top: 199px;
}
#homeDiv3 {
	height: 115px;
	width: 97px;
	position: absolute;
	left: 751px;
	top: 347px;
}
#homeDiv4 {
	height: 79px;
	width: 121px;
	position: absolute;
	left: 399px;
	top: 374px;
	color: #658426;
}
#homeDiv5 {
	height: 82px;
	width: 142px;
	position: absolute;
	left: 570px;
	top: 369px;
}
#homeDiv6 {
	height: 50px;
	width: 458px;
	position: absolute;
	left: 390px;
	top: 524px;
	color: #485E1C;
}
#centreMap {
	height: 670px;
	position: relative;
}






ul#nav {
	height: 30px;
	background-image: url(../images/nav/nav_bg.gif);
	background-repeat: no-repeat;
	background-position: left top;
	clear: both;
	padding-left: 0;
}
ul#nav li {
float: left;
	display: inline;
	margin-bottom: 0;
}
ul#nav a {
	display: block;
	height: 30px;
	text-indent: -9999px;
	border-bottom-style: none;
	padding-bottom: 0px;
}

ul#nav li#nav1 a { width: 54px; }
ul#nav li#nav1 a:hover, ul#nav li#nav1 a#active { background-image: url(../images/nav/1.gif); }
ul#nav li#nav2 a { width: 58px; }
ul#nav li#nav2 a:hover, ul#nav li#nav2 a#active { background-image: url(../images/nav/2.gif); }
ul#nav li#nav3 a { width: 80px; }
ul#nav li#nav3 a:hover, ul#nav li#nav3 a#active { background-image: url(../images/nav/3.gif); }
ul#nav li#nav4 a { width: 76px; }
ul#nav li#nav4 a:hover, ul#nav li#nav4 a#active { background-image: url(../images/nav/4.gif); }
ul#nav li#nav5 a { width: 92px; }
ul#nav li#nav5 a:hover, ul#nav li#nav5 a#active { background-image: url(../images/nav/5.gif); }
ul#nav li#nav6 a { width: 93px; }
ul#nav li#nav6 a:hover, ul#nav li#nav6 a#active { background-image: url(../images/nav/6.gif); }
ul#nav li#nav7 a { width: 54px; }
ul#nav li#nav7 a:hover, ul#nav li#nav7 a#active { background-image: url(../images/nav/7.gif); }
ul#nav li#nav8 a { width: 104px; }
ul#nav li#nav8 a:hover, ul#nav li#nav8 a#active { background-image: url(../images/nav/8.gif); }
ul#nav li#nav9 a { width: 115px; }
ul#nav li#nav9 a:hover, ul#nav li#nav9 a#active { background-image: url(../images/nav/9.gif); }
ul#nav li#nav10 a { width: 78px; }
ul#nav li#nav10 a:hover, ul#nav li#nav10 a#active { background-image: url(../images/nav/10.gif); }
ul#nav li#nav11 a { width: 76px; }
ul#nav li#nav11 a:hover, ul#nav li#nav11 a#active { background-image: url(../images/nav/11.gif); }




.ra {
	float: left;
	color: #94B84C;
	padding-top: 4px;
}
.copy {
	float: right;
	height: 20px;
	width: 170px;
	background-image: url(../images/copy.gif);
	text-indent: -9999px;
}
#footer a {	color: #94B84C;}
#tel p {margin-bottom: 0;}
.subNav {
	position: absolute;
	left: 545px;
	top: 122px;
	color: #9DC3E0;
	width: 344px;
}
.subNav a {
	color: #9DC3E0;
	text-decoration: none;
	margin-right: 4px;
	margin-left: 4px;
}
.subNav a:hover {	color: #658426;}

#innerContent img {
	float: left;
	padding: 4px;
	border: 1px solid #BFD591;
	margin-right: 10px;
	clear: left;
	margin-bottom: 10px;
}
#innerContent a {
	border-bottom-color: #9CC3E0;
	color: #74ABD3;
}
#innerContent a:hover {
	border-bottom-color: #84AB32;
	color: #306A96;
}
.normalImage {
	float: none;
	clear: none;
	margin: 0px;
	border-top-style: none;
	border-right-style: none;
	border-bottom-style: none;
	border-left-style: none;
}

